#6381c1 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#6381c1 is composed of 38.8% red, 50.6% green and 75.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 48.7% cyan, 33.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 24.3% black. It has a hue angle of 220.9 degrees, a saturation of 43.1% and a lightness of 57.3%. #6381c1 color hex could be obtained by blending #c6ffff with #000383. Closest websafe color is: #6699cc.

Shades and Tints of #6381c1

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#05070c is the darkest color, while #fdfefe is the lightest one.

Tones of #6381c1

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8d9097 is the less saturated color, while #286cfc is the most saturated one.
